A boy identified as Chukwu has been arrested for killing and dumping the corpse of his orphaned girlfriend in the gutter at Madumere Street in Owerri Municipal Council of Imo State.

The Incident which took place on January 7, 2024, between the hours of 11 pm and 12 midnight is generating panic and concerns among the residents and Imo indigenes who are wondering how the young woman was murdered in cold blood.

The deceased spotted a red skirt, gold earrings, and gold necklace, and was seen in a drainage, soaked in the pool of her blood near an uncompleted building on the same street.

The deceased whose name was not disclosed hailed from Umuayala, Egbu in Owerri North LGA.

The residents have expressed shock that the suspect’s relations including a retired police commissioner are fighting hard to sweep the case under the carpet so that the suspect would evade prosecution.

A source who craved anonymity said the case was first reported at the Owerri Urban Police Station, where he disclosed that police wanted to play funny before the case was reported to CP Monitoring at Homicide 2 Department, Imo State Police Command where authorities ordered the arrest of the suspect.

He said: “The young lady is an orphan from Owerri North LGA and the boyfriend is from Madumere Street from Owerri Municipal Council.

“The boy has been arrested and is cooling off at the homicide department of command,” he said.

Narrating the incident he said: “This case happened on January 7, 2024.

” When I noticed it, I raised the alarm which attracted the residents to the spot where the corpse was dumped in a gutter near an uncompleted building. So I evacuated the body and I paid every bill including the mortuary bill and we went to the police in Owerri Urban where the police were trying to be funny, I transferred it to CP monitoring.

“We later set up a surveillance group about four of them, including my lawyers, to go into that community on surveillance. My Deputy PG also was there on surveillance. We also mobilised the whole vigilante in the area.

“We then threatened to make the police arrest all the boys on the street if they would not tell us exactly who killed this girl because in that community there are gates in every street that are being locked by 11 pm.

“So how come that such a corpse was dumped at Madumere Street and nobody saw them?

“So, it was supposed to be within, we threatened them and they confessed that that woman was a girlfriend to one of the vigilante boys and the same boy was the one that killed his girlfriend on Friday night.”

He said that the people reported that they saw the suspect with the victim on January 5th, 2024 around Onumiri very far from Madumere Street about two poles where the suspect resides adding that on that Friday night the girl was with the suspect.

When contacted, the police spokesman in the state, Henry Okoye said, “The suspect is still in Police Custody, the Command intends to carry out an autopsy to ascertain the cause of death of the victim. The suspect will be arraigned in court after a comprehensive investigation.”

“So after the vigilantes had written their report at the state CID Homicide 2. Then we went onto surveillance again, and we continued until the suspect was arrested using my lawyers and everything at our disposal because the boy wanted to run away, we tracked him and he was arrested.

“We also tried to track the deceased families and now found out that the deceased family is from Umuayala Egbu. So, we eventually got the sister and brother. They confessed that the boy had been a friend of their sister for four years and that there was a time he came to say he wanted to marry the girl and the same boy is married already.

“So we brought brother and sister to the homicide section and we had their statement and later the police paraded the boy at the sight of the scene. My deputy PG took them to the place to show them everything that had happened and they took the police to his boy’s house.

“Now we realised that the boy has a retired commissioner of police who was bent in closing the case and secondly the deceased family wanted to settle with the deceased family because they (deceased family) are so poor and scared because they don’t want any trouble as they claimed they have nobody to fight on their behalf because the suspect family has been threatening fire and brimstones.

“But we have been told the deceased’s family to be strong and that we are with them but they have been so scared because they don’t have anybody. “

The source further said: “The suspect’s family wanted to negotiate with the deceased’s family so that they could negotiate the burial and pay the bride price but the bride price is not the future of the deceased. So the question is why was she killed and dumped in a gutter in that manner? Was it that she was not a human being?.”

He expressed sadness at how the victim was killed and dumped, “human beings should not be treated that way. I want the suspect to confess those who did it with him. I am calling on Nigerians to assist and call these people to order and make sure justice is given.”

A legal practitioner, Barrister Chinedu Ifeanyi Iloeje, has publicly declared that a man previously believed to be his son is not biologically related to him, following the outcome of a DNA test.

In a public notice published in a newspaper, Iloeje stated that he was allegedly misled by the man’s mother into believing that the individual, identified as Chinedu Francis Iloeje, was his biological son.

According to the notice, DNA testing conducted on the matter established “beyond any doubt” that the man is not his son.

The lawyer further clarified that he never legally adopted the individual, despite the latter bearing the name Chinedu Francis Iloeje.

Barrister Iloeje explained that the man’s original name is Chinedu Francis Onwualu and stressed that he has no legal or biological relationship with him.

The notice also informed members of the public, the Greater Iloeje Family, the Umuodu Village Union, Uwani Amokwe Town Union, St. Theresa’s Catholic Church Amokwe, Udi Local Government Council, and other stakeholders of his declaration.

Maduka College Advert

He stated that the disclaimer was made in good faith and while of sound mind, urging the public to take note of the clarification.

The publication has sparked discussions on paternity disputes and the increasing reliance on DNA testing to resolve questions of biological parentage.

Presidential candidate of the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C) in the forthcoming 2027 general election, Mr. Peter Obi, has donated N10 million to assist in the renovation of the burnt Mother of Christ Specialist Hospital, Enugu State.

The former Anambra State governor handed over the cheque for the donation to the hospital management team when he visited the hospital yesterday.

The hospital belongs to the Reverend Sisters of the Immaculate Heart of the Catholic Church.

Mr Peter Obi inspecting the burnt hospital

Addressing the hospital management team after inspecting parts of the burnt hospital, the NDC presidential candidate commended them for their efforts in contributing to healthcare delivery services.

Telling them that even though they might feel that they were not being appreciated for what they were doing, Obi, however, described healthcare delivery services and education as among the “most critical needs of society” and urged them not to relent in what they were doing.

The Federal Government and Enugu State Government are in talks to ensure the commencement of direct cargo flight operations between Enugu and Guangzhou, China, before the end of the year.

The Minister of Aviation and Aerospace Development, Barr Festus Keyamo, disclosed this in Lagos during the launch of the United Air’s newly acquired airplanes on Thursday.

The Minister added said the FG had affected a structural management overhaul at the Akanu Ibiam International Airport, also bringing the airport under a privately run operational framework.

Enugu Airline

“One of our prides in the South is the Enugu International Airport. The Enugu governor approached Mr. President, noting that the airport was not maximising its economic potential under standard bureaucratic structures, and requested to bring in private investors to run it. Mr. President gave the green light.

“As I speak with you, Enugu is now fully privately owned and fully supported by state government, with the clear objective of also turning it into a dedicated cargo hub for the entire Southeast.”

To this effect, therefore, Keyamo said that a high-level bilateral trade negotiations were ongoing with a view to securing direct logistics flights between China and the Southeast by the end of 2026.

“Just two days ago, the Enugu governor and I were actively negotiating the first direct cargo flight from Guangzhou, China, straight into Enugu.

“We are targeting December for the maiden flight. This will allow our Southeast merchants and traders in China to consolidate their goods into unified cargo accounts twice a week, flying straight into Enugu for seamless delivery to hubs like Onitsha and Aba,” he concluded.

It is recalled that Governor Mbah had in July 2025 launched Enugu Air, a state-owned airline, as part of the administration’s integrated blueprint for a modern, multimodal transport ecosystem and the vision to make Enugu a major aviation and logistics hub.

Since then, Enugu Air has grown its fleet from three at inception to six planes with plans to further increase it as it prepares to commence operations to regional destinations like Accra, Libreville, Abidjan in next few months and long haul flight operations to various destinations around the world by the end of the year.
